The Nurse Practitioner (NP) works in our team-based care environment.
We are a value-based care provider focused on quality of care for the patients we serve.
Our care team consists of doctors, advanced practice professionals, Pharm D, Care Coach Nurse, MA, Behavioral health specialist, Quality-based Coder, Referral Coordinator and more.
Our approach allows us to provide an unmatched experience for seniors.
Our model positions itself to provide higher quality care and better outcomes for seniors, providing a concierge experience, diverse services, coordinated care supported by analytics and tools, and deep community relationships.
This support allows our Nurse Practitioner to see fewer patients and spend more time with them.
You will have a Master's Degree in Nursing or completion of a PA program with board certification. You will have an active, unrestricted NP or PA license in the state of practice. CenterWell Senior Primary Care provides proactive, preventive care to seniors, including wellness visits, physical exams, chronic condition management, screenings, minor injury treatment and more. Our unique care model focuses on personalized experiences, taking time to listen, learn and address the factors that impact patient well-being. Our integrated care teams, which include physicians, nurses, behavioral health specialists and more, spend up to 50 percent more time with patients, providing compassionate, personalized care that brings better health outcomes. We go beyond physical health by also addressing other factors that can impact a patient’s well-being.
